How Do Stairlifts Work?

Stairlifts are designed to make climbing stairs easier. They are equipped with safety features such as seatbelts and seat tracks. These features are critical to the safety of the user. Stairlifts can have a fixed seat height or adjustable seats. The engineer who installs the lift determines the right seat height for the user.

A stairlift has several parts, and each of these parts serves a specific function. A seat and motor are the primary parts, but other parts are necessary as well. Each part is designed to be both efficient and safe for the user. This article looks at the different parts and how they work.

Some stairlift models have call and send controls. These controls are mounted near the end of the staircase. This is useful if there are multiple people using the staircase. Another option is a wireless remote control. This feature allows for the user to control the movements of the chair without having to leave the living space.

A stairlift is essentially a chair that travels on a track. It has a motor located in the base. The motor turns a geared strip on the rail and guides the chair up and down the stairs. In addition to this, some models feature track overruns, which allow for safer access and exit from the chair lift. This feature is also useful for those who want to avoid falls on stairs.

The basic principle of how stairlifts work is the same for all types of stairlifts. Generally, straight stairlifts are made of a track that follows the length of a staircase. The track is attached to the staircase and the carriage is securely mounted on it. A geared drive cog in the carriage is permanently engaged with a rack on the rail. The basic operation of a stairlift has not changed since it was first invented by C. Crispen in 1923.

A stairlift can be run on two batteries or directly from the mains. The batteries of a stairlift are rechargeable and can last for a long time even when there is a power outage. Some lifts can even work without a plug for short periods.
